WebSep 26, 2000 · A small-world network is characterized by the following properties: ( i) the local neighborhood is preserved (as for regular lattices; ref. 2 ); and ( ii) the diameter of the network, quantified by average shortest distance between two vertices ( 20 ), increases logarithmically with the number of vertices n (as for random graphs; ref. 21 ). A small world network is characterized by a small average shortest path length, and a large clustering coefficient. Small-worldness is commonly measured with the coefficient sigma or omega. Both coefficients compare the average clustering coefficient and shortest path length of a …

WebOct 6, 2003 · A 'small-world' network is one where nodes are connected by both long and short links (Barabási, 2002; Salingaros, 2001). Starting from a set of nodes with only nearest-neighbor interactions, add a few longer links at random. The result is a drastically improved overall connectivity. WebThis example shows how to construct and analyze a Watts-Strogatz small-world graph. The Watts-Strogatz model is a random graph that has small-world network properties, such as clustering and short average path length.

Kleinberg’s model presents the infinite family of navigable Small-World networks that generalizes Watts-Strogatz model. Moreover, with Kleinberg’s model it is shown that short paths not only exist but can be found with limited knowledge of the global network.
